WebPlace the tarnished silverware in the foil-lined container or the aluminum baking tray. Pour boiling baking soda water on top of silverware, submerge each piece entirely. Wait 10 seconds or longer for very tarnished silverware. Remove each piece of silver using kitchen tongs. Dry with a clean dishtowel.
